You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@beam.apache.org by tg...@apache.org on 2017/05/04 22:55:30 UTC

[3/3] beam git commit: This closes #2695

This closes #2695


Project: http://git-wip-us.apache.org/repos/asf/beam/repo
Commit: http://git-wip-us.apache.org/repos/asf/beam/commit/defb5540
Tree: http://git-wip-us.apache.org/repos/asf/beam/tree/defb5540
Diff: http://git-wip-us.apache.org/repos/asf/beam/diff/defb5540

Branch: refs/heads/master
Commit: defb55405f1bbbd33e74dd3551b2d0f0c358a55d
Parents: 8af5c28 d59d9b7
Author: Thomas Groh <tg...@google.com>
Authored: Thu May 4 15:55:17 2017 -0700
Committer: Thomas Groh <tg...@google.com>
Committed: Thu May 4 15:55:17 2017 -0700

----------------------------------------------------------------------
 .../beam/runners/core/BaseExecutionContext.java |   9 --
 .../apache/beam/runners/core/DoFnAdapters.java  | 111 ++++++++++---
 .../beam/runners/core/ExecutionContext.java     |  10 +-
 ...eBoundedSplittableProcessElementInvoker.java |  13 +-
 .../beam/runners/core/SimpleDoFnRunner.java     | 161 +++++++++++++++----
 .../beam/runners/core/SplittableParDo.java      |  35 ++--
 .../beam/runners/core/SimpleDoFnRunnerTest.java |   4 +-
 .../beam/runners/core/SplittableParDoTest.java  |   4 +-
 runners/google-cloud-dataflow-java/pom.xml      |   2 +-
 .../runners/dataflow/BatchViewOverrides.java    |   2 +-
 .../java/org/apache/beam/sdk/io/WriteFiles.java |   7 +-
 .../beam/sdk/options/PipelineOptions.java       |   3 +-
 .../org/apache/beam/sdk/transforms/Combine.java |   5 +-
 .../org/apache/beam/sdk/transforms/DoFn.java    |  79 ++++++---
 .../apache/beam/sdk/transforms/DoFnTester.java  |  62 ++++---
 .../beam/sdk/transforms/GroupIntoBatches.java   |   2 +-
 .../org/apache/beam/sdk/transforms/ParDo.java   |   5 +-
 .../reflect/ByteBuddyDoFnInvokerFactory.java    |  19 ++-
 .../sdk/transforms/reflect/DoFnInvoker.java     |  19 ++-
 .../sdk/transforms/reflect/DoFnSignature.java   |  42 +++--
 .../sdk/transforms/reflect/DoFnSignatures.java  |  58 +++++--
 .../beam/sdk/transforms/windowing/PaneInfo.java |   3 +-
 .../apache/beam/sdk/metrics/MetricsTest.java    |   4 +-
 .../beam/sdk/transforms/DoFnTesterTest.java     |   8 +-
 .../beam/sdk/transforms/ParDoLifecycleTest.java |  16 +-
 .../apache/beam/sdk/transforms/ParDoTest.java   |  75 ++-------
 .../beam/sdk/transforms/SplittableDoFnTest.java |   4 +-
 .../transforms/reflect/DoFnInvokersTest.java    |  22 ++-
 .../transforms/reflect/DoFnSignaturesTest.java  |  15 +-
 .../control/ProcessBundleHandlerTest.java       |  17 +-
 .../sdk/io/elasticsearch/ElasticsearchIO.java   |  12 +-
 .../sdk/io/gcp/bigquery/StreamingWriteFn.java   |   4 +-
 .../sdk/io/gcp/bigquery/TagWithUniqueIds.java   |   2 +-
 .../io/gcp/bigquery/WriteBundlesToFiles.java    |  17 +-
 .../beam/sdk/io/gcp/bigtable/BigtableIO.java    |   4 +-
 .../beam/sdk/io/gcp/datastore/DatastoreV1.java  |  10 +-
 .../apache/beam/sdk/io/gcp/pubsub/PubsubIO.java |   4 +-
 .../sdk/io/gcp/pubsub/PubsubUnboundedSink.java  |   4 +-
 .../java/org/apache/beam/sdk/io/hdfs/Write.java |   7 +-
 .../org/apache/beam/sdk/io/hbase/HBaseIO.java   |   7 +-
 .../org/apache/beam/sdk/io/jdbc/JdbcIO.java     |  11 +-
 .../java/org/apache/beam/sdk/io/jms/JmsIO.java  |   6 +-
 .../org/apache/beam/sdk/io/kafka/KafkaIO.java   |   2 +-
 .../beam/sdk/io/mongodb/MongoDbGridFSIO.java    |   4 +-
 .../apache/beam/sdk/io/mongodb/MongoDbIO.java   |  10 +-
 45 files changed, 603 insertions(+), 317 deletions(-)
----------------------------------------------------------------------